Limitations
If during the warranty period (5 years as from the date of
purchase), a problem covered by the warranty were to arise,
SHARK, through the intermediary of its sales network, under-
takes to repair or replace any defective components, up to a
maximum limit which is the purchase value of the helmet.
Any labour costs are normally paid by the SHARK network,
but are submitted for approval prior to the work being car-
ried out. If the repair requires components to be dispatched
incurring transportation costs, the SHARK network shall cover
these costs up to a limit which is the cost of transport by the
national postal service at the normal rate.
Exclusions
This warranty only covers problems related to materials or
manufacturing. SHARK cannot be held liable with regard to
the product in the following cases :
Any damage following
1) a fall or accident
2) a technical modification made by the user or a third party
(glue, adhesives, paint, screws, etc.)
3) use of or contact with: harmful chemical products (inclu-
ding methylated spirits on the visor treatments), or an intense
heat source
4) incorrect use: abnormal conditions (e.g. underwater), lack
of maintenance or care
5) ageing due to normal wear of the inner fabrics or foams,
the appearance of the external parts, or the visor (scratches,
marks, etc.)
6) abnormal and prolonged exposure to ultra-violet light, in
particular for the decorative colours. In addition, SHARK can-
not consider subjective considerations related to use of the
helmet as defects covered by the warranty : problems with
comfort, size, noise or whistling, aerodynamics, etc.
